Transaction f38c785211723033b152b244668a4e5e965ccd0ca59a8ba79b4b90822143b3a7

2 Input
2 Outputs
  • f38c785211723033b152b244668a4e5e965ccd0ca59a8ba79b4b90822143b3a7:0
  • value  30145729
    address  3H2zxsGSmY9dhFXrcAncwdvCQmPcFRN1Px
  • f38c785211723033b152b244668a4e5e965ccd0ca59a8ba79b4b90822143b3a7:1
  • value  3243
    address  bc1qhzn3dmvv5290rjyr899wck0rcx4zlpzjxfxznx